Helsinki Region at Expo 2010 Shanghai
The Helsinki Region is participating in Finland’s largest international promotion effort to date at Expo 2010 Shanghai China, which celebrated its grand opening on May 1st. Helsinki joins Nokia and Kone with a noteworthy presence in Finland’s Expo pavilion named “Kirnu”.
Helsinki presents itself under five themes at the Expo: (1) tourism and conventions in the Greater Helsinki Region, (2) Education, (3) Design & Culture, (4) Innovations and (5) Cleantech & Environment. Helsinki’s presence is coordinated by Greater Helsinki Promotion, the region’s joint company for international marketing and economic development.
Each theme will be highlighted with a dedicated event at Kirnu, aimed at corroborating old liaisons and creating new long-term relationships. The catalyst for each themed event is contacts created by key Chinese players in Helsinki, when they were hosted by their Finnish counterparts prior to the Expo. These visits were organized under the Invitation to Helsinki programme. The Chinese guests have recorded their experiences in Helsinki, which can be found on the Invitation to Helsinki pages, http://www.invitationtohelsinki.fi.
The overriding theme of Expo 2010 Shanghai is Better City, Better Life. The theme offers a good opportunity for the Helsinki Region to display its strengths and solutions for high-quality urban life. The theme coincides with the Region’s ambitions as World Design Capital 2012, when it seeks to find solutions from design for building better cities.
Shanghai is an opportune springboard for the Helsinki Region into the Chinese markets as the city already has the largest concentration of Finnish corporate and public-sector representatives outside Europe.
